Paltry

paltry \PAWL-tree\, adjective:
1.
almost worthless; trifling
2. of no worth; contemptible, despicable

Poultry. Cold, damp, goose-pimpled. Layered with a thin, slimy membrane of skin. She runs her fingers over it, feels its slight give with her slight pressure. Readying herself for what she knows she has to do, that as a child she told herself she would never do. Like cooking raw hamburger meat. She could never be in the kitchen as a girl when her mother was making tacos, as the pink flesh turned to brown, sizzling in the pan, withering away in its own juices. The smell so awful and thick, it permeated everything.
Now she stands at the kitchen sink, staring down at a featherless bird with its head and feet cut off, trying to muck up the courage to actually hold the thing in her hands and push globs of stuffing into its hollowed center with her bony, shaking fingers.
